Bitlayer has emerged as the first modular Zero-Knowledge Proof (ZKP) Layer 2 protocol for Bitcoin, aiming to redefine Bitcoin’s programmability and scalability. Its mission is clear: introduce greater scalability and flexibility while preserving Bitcoin’s core security, enabling developers and users to build a decentralized application platform. With Bitlayer, BTC transitions from digital gold to active participation in DeFi, NFTs, gaming, and the broader Web3 ecosystem.
Bitlayer isn’t just another Bitcoin scaling solution; it integrates ZKP and modular architecture into Bitcoin Layer 2 to deliver a protocol layer that is secure, efficient, and highly composable. Its key differentiators include:
Security anchored to the Bitcoin mainnet: All asset and transaction security is ultimately backed by the Bitcoin network, ensuring user funds remain uncompromised.
Accelerated verification via ZKP: Using ZKP technology, transaction and smart contract verification are faster and more efficient, minimizing the high costs of traditional on-chain verification.
Modular components: Bitlayer uses modular components, allowing developers to select modules for consensus, execution, or data availability based on application requirements.
Programmability for the Bitcoin ecosystem: Bitlayer expands Bitcoin’s capabilities, enabling it to perform complex smart contract functions beyond simple peer-to-peer transfers.
Bitlayer transforms Bitcoin’s role from just a store of value to a foundational application protocol, filling a strategic gap in the crypto market.

At the heart of the Bitlayer ecosystem is BTR, its native utility token, with a fixed total supply of 1 billion to prevent inflation from additional issuance. BTR’s critical functions include:
Ecosystem incentives: BTR will reward developers, users, and partners, encouraging DApp and protocol adoption on Bitlayer.
Governance: BTR holders can participate in network governance, including proposal votes and parameter changes, supporting decentralization and community leadership.
Transaction and fee payments: BTR is the primary medium for paying fees and executing actions on the Bitlayer network.
Staking and security: By staking BTR, users and validators secure the network and receive associated rewards.
This multi-utility design transforms BTR from a simple investment asset into the key fuel that powers Bitlayer’s ecosystem operations.
